The Graduate Aptitude Test in Engineering 2025 will be conducted by IIT Roorkee. The GATE 2025 will feature 30 test papers, including full and sectional papers.
GATE 2025: IIT Roorkee will conduct GATE 2025 for applicants interested in postgraduate engineering programs. The syllabus and exam pattern are available on the new official website, gate.iitr.ac.in. The exam is anticipated to take place on Feb 1, 2, 8, and 9, 2025, and the registration process will begin around Aug 31, 2024.
The duration of GATE exam will be 3 hours and consist of multiple-choice and numerical answer questions. There will be thirty subjects, including CSE, EE, EC, ME, and Data Science (DA), and many more GATE 2025 exam.
The eligibility criteria are that candidates must be in their third year or above in any undergraduate program or have completed their degree program from a recognised institute, such as engineering, technology, architecture, science, commerce, the arts, or humanities.

GATE 2025: Exam Dates
The GATE exam dates are tabulated below for candidates with its tentative schedule for candidate's reference:
Event | Tentative Dates |
Application Form | Aug 31, 2024 |
Application Form Last Date (without late fee) | Oct 13, 2024 |
Last Day to Fill Application Form (with additional fee) | Oct 20, 2024 |
Application Form Correction | Nov 7 to 11, 2024 |
Admit Card Date | Jan 4, 2025 |
Exam Date | Feb 1, 2, 8 and 9, 2025 |
Availability of Response Sheet | Feb 16, 2025 |
Release of Provisional Answer Key | Feb 21, 2025 |
Raise Objection against Provisional Answer Key | Feb 22 to 25, 2025 |
Release of Final Answer Key | Mar 15, 2025 |
Result Date | Mar 16, 2025 |

GATE 2025 Eligibility Criteria
The exam conducting body will release the GATE Exam Eligibility Criteria 2025 very soon on its official website but according to the previous years standards students can have an idea of the general eligibility rule.
- Candidates must have completed 10+2+2 or 10+3+1 and are currently enrolled in the third or higher year of any UG program.
- Candidates who graduated from any government-approved degree program in Engineering, Technology, Architecture, Science, Commerce, or Arts are eligible to apply for admission to IIT M.Tech.
- There is no age limit set as the criteria to appear in the GATE exam.
GATE 2025 Exam Pattern
The detailed exam pattern is tabulated down below for candidates to have a clear understanding of GATE 2025 exam pattern:
Particulars | Details |
Examination Mode | Computer Based Test |
Language | English |
Duration | 3 hours (180 minutes) |
Number of GATE Papers | 30 Papers |
Total Number of Questions | 65 Questions (including 10 questions from General Aptitude) |
Total Marks | 100 Marks |
Sections | General Aptitude (GA) + Selected subject |
Type of Questions | Multiple Choice Questions (MCQ), Multiple Select Questions (MSQ), and/or Numerical Answer Type (NAT) Questions |
Design of Questions | Recall, Comprehension, Application, Analysis & Synthesis |
Marking Scheme | Questions carry 1 mark or 2 marks |

GATE 2025 Counselling
In the GATE counselling 2025 the participating institutes will issue admission notifications outlining their varied admission processes after the GATE 2025 results are announced. Then, qualified candidates can submit an application for admission to the institute of their choice by following the guidelines provided by the institute.
The important steps includes application submission, shortlisting for interviews, and document verification in the GATE 2025 counseling process.
The final selection list will be determined by the respective institutes according to the student's academic record, GATE score, and performance in the interview.
